On March 18th, Nebraska’s LB 257 was placed on the General File, the first stage of legislative debate in the unicameral chamber. We are thrilled to report that the bill was successfully passed through this stage, a critical moment in the legislative journey.
Passage from the General File means that the bill has passed its first-floor debate and now enters the final stretch of the legislative process. This success underscores the strong support for licensure portability.
We’re grateful to the Nebraska legislators who supported the bill and to the Nebraska Association for Marriage and Family Therapy, which has stayed engaged throughout the process. This progress brings us closer to making portability a reality for MFTs in Nebraska.
We remain hopeful as the bill proceeds to the Select File for its second debate.
